& Front passenger’s frontal
airbag ON and OFF indica-
tors
or
: Front passenger
’s frontal airbag
ON indicator
or
: Front passenger
’s frontal airbag
OFF indicator
The front passenger
’s frontal airbag ON
and OFF indicators show you the status of
the front passenger
’s SRS frontal airbag.
The indicators are located between the
map lights.
When the ignition switch is turned to the
“ON” position, both the ON and OFF
indicators illuminate for 6 seconds during
which time the system is checked. Follow-
ing the system check, both indicators
extinguish for 2 seconds. After that, one
of the indicators illuminates depending on
the status of the front passenger
’s SRS
frontal airbag determined by the SUBARU
advanced frontal airbag system monitor-
ing.
If the front passenger
’s SRS frontal airbag
is activated, the passenger
’s frontal airbag
ON indicator will illuminate while the OFF
indicator will remain extinguished.
If the front passenger
’s SRS frontal airbag
is deactivated, the passenger
’s frontal
airbag ON indicator will remain extin-
guished while the OFF indicator will
illuminate.
If both the ON and OFF indicators remain
lit or extinguished simultaneously, the
system is faulty. Contact your SUBARU
dealer immediately for an inspection.
